#### createbootvolfromautonbi.py
|
||||
|
||||
A tool to make bootable disk volumes from the output of autonbi. Especially
|
||||
useful to make bootable disks containing Imagr and the 'SIP-ignoring' kernel,
|
||||
which allows Imagr to run scripts that affect SIP state, set UAKEL options, and
|
||||
run the `startosinstall` component, all of which might otherwise require network
|
||||
booting from a NetInstall-style nbi.
|
||||
|
||||
This provides a way to create a bootable external disk that acts like the Netboot environment used by/needed by Imagr.
|
||||
|
||||
This command converts the output of Imagr's `make nbi` into a bootable external USB disk:
|
||||
`sudo ./createbootvolfromautonbi.py --nbi ~/Desktop/10.13.6_Imagr.nbi --volume /Volumes/ExternalDisk`

#### installinstallmacos.py
|
||||
|
||||
This script can create disk images containing macOS Installer applications available via Apple's softwareupdate catalogs.
|
||||
|
||||
It does this by downloading the packages from Apple's softwareupdate servers and then installing them into a new empty disk image.
|
||||
|
||||
Since it is using Apple's installer, any install check or volume check scripts are run. This means that you can only use this tool to create a diskimage containing the versions of macOS that will run on the exact machine you are running the script on.
|
||||
|
||||
For example, to create a diskimage containing the version 10.13.6 that runs on 2018 MacBook Pros, you must run this script on a 2018 MacBook Pro, and choose the proper version.
|
||||
|
||||
Typically "forked" OS build numbers are 4 digits, so when this document was last updated, build 17G2208 was the correct build for 2018 MacBook Pros; 17G65 was the correct build for all other Macs that support High Sierra.
|
||||
|
||||
If you attempt to install an incompatible version of macOS, you'll see an error similar to the following:
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
Making empty sparseimage...
|
||||
installer: Error - ERROR_B14B14D9B7
|
||||
Command '['/usr/sbin/installer', '-pkg', './content/downloads/07/20/091-95774/awldiototubemmsbocipx0ic9lj2kcu0pt/091-95774.English.dist', '-target', '/private/tmp/dmg.Hf0PHy']' returned non-zero exit status 1
|
||||
Product installation failed.
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Use a compatible Mac or select a different build compatible with your current hardware and try again.
|
||||
|
||||
Run `./installinstallmacos.py --help` to see the available options.

#### make_firmwareupdater_pkg.sh
|
||||
|
||||
This script was used to extract the firmware updaters from early High Sierra installers and make a standalone installer package that could be used to upgrade Mac firmware before installing High Sierra via imaging.
|
||||
|
||||
Later High Sierra installer changes have broken this script; since installing High Sierra via imaging is not recommended or supported by Apple and several other alternatives are now available, I don't plan on attempting to fix or upgrade this tool.
